I am hoping you can help. I am trying out my first cycle of clomid + IUI. I have had a history of high FSH (but all else looks "normal")- so we weren't sure how I would respond to the Clomid. I took 50 mg of Clomid on days 5-9 and today is day 12. I went in for an U/S this morning and found out that my lining is 7.7 and I have 2 follicles on one side (19 and 11 mm) and 2 on the other side also (15 and 9 mm). I am going back for another U/S Friday morning.
My regular RE is on vacation, so I saw a new RE today. I usually ask a million questions...but between hearing about some questionable biopsy results from the nurse (that turned out to be nothing) and having a new doctor...I must not have been thinking straight. My question for you guys is...does this seem "on track" so far? How many follicles and what sizes are normal or do doctor's like to see?

Sounds perfect to me. I am assuming they did bloodwork as well and are tracking your e2 and LH?
Those numbers sound excellent. They grow about 1.5 per day, so you'll be looking at 23, 14, 17 by about then. The 23 and 17 should O.
